Output 013ddd29c0bcb1eea9f17b527c23e8fad398519400dd23c0f03cf2203741b256: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d08c6578a3ab81cfc01361c31a847beea5df97cf OP_EQUAL
address
3LhifMZuiKAtxxWk7xTPdc1PEr9a6dmhcE
transaction
013ddd29c0bcb1eea9f17b527c23e8fad398519400dd23c0f03cf2203741b256
spent
true